Cabinet may send 4 Jordanians home to serve prison sentences
By Barak Ravid, Haaretz Correspondent and The Associated Press

The Cabinet is to consider a proposal to send four Jordanians home
to serve out their life prison terms for 1990 cross-border attacks, Prime
Minister Ehud Olmert's office said Wednesday in a statement.

The proposal, filed by Prime Minister Ehud Olmert, Foreign Minister Tzipi Livni, Justice Minister Daniel Friedmann, and Public Security Minister Avi Dichter, will be put before the Cabinet on Sunday, the statement said. It is expected to be approved.

Three of the armed men, who were Jordanian policemen, infiltrated Israel from Jordan in November 1990, sparking a firefight that killed IDF Capt. Yehuda Lifshitz. The other killed Sgt. Pinchas Levy.

Representatives from the justice ministry contacted both families and notified them that the issue of releasing the prisoners would come up in the next cabinet meeting. The representatives offered to relay the families' opinions on the matter in writing to the ministers.

In the proposal, the ministers wrote that the decision would symbolize a gesture to Jordan. "There is no change in other governmental decisions regarding the release of other security prisoners, and the decision has nothing to do with releasing Palestinian or other prisoners," the proposal read.

Former Prime Minister Ariel Sharon had agreed to release Jordanian prisoners- ten prisoners were freed in the "Tennenbaum deal" with Hezbollah, and another seven were released in April 2005. Sharon opposed releasing prisoners with "blood on their hands," and rejected Jordan's repeating request to free the four Jordanians, one of them being a brother of a Jordanian parliament member.

In February, Olmert said he had accepted a request from King Abdullah II of Jordan to send the four back to Jordan, where they would serve out their prison sentences. At the time, a Jordanian official said legal issues still had to be worked out.
